IronPigs suffer third straight loss to Syracuse

May 1, 2019 - International League (IL1)
Lehigh Valley IronPigs News Release


(Allentown, Pa) - The Lehigh Valley IronPigs (16-9) lost their third straight game to the Syracuse Mets (17-9) on Wednesday evening as they lost 8-2.

Syracuse jumped out to a 2-0 lead off Tyler Viza (0-1) in the top of the first inning. Carlos Gomez hit a sacrifice fly while Travis Taiijeron added an RBI single. The Mets scored another run off Viza in the top of the third inning when Danny Espinosa hit an RBI single. Matt McBride hit an RBI double off Corey Oswalt (3-0) in the bottom of the second inning to cut the Mets lead to 3-1.

The Mets got runs in the top of the fifth and sixth innings off Viza and Austin Davis then scored three more runs in the top of the eighth inning off Tom Windle. Lehigh Valley did get a run in the bottom of the sixth inning. McBride scored on an RBI groundout by Ali Castillo.

Lehigh Valley did load the bases in the bottom of the eighth inning, but Lane Adams struck out swinging to end the game. Paul Sewald closed out the game for Syracuse.

The IronPigs and Syracuse Mets wrap up their series on Thursday morning at 10:35.
